On Sunday evening in Bordeaux, Deschamps’ men will be on the pitch for the second test to prepare for the European Championships in Germany

More pre-European tests for the national teams that have signed up for Euro 2024 which is just around the corner. Also on the field are the world vice champions, that France which does not hide the ambition of returning to take back the continental throne after twenty-three years of fasting.

After the 3-0 success against Luxembourg, marked by goals from Kolo Muani, Jonathan Clauss and Kylian Mbappé, Didier Deschamps’ boys are looking for confirmation against Canada who they will face in the Stade Matmut-Atlantique in the city of Bordeaux next Sunday 9 June at 9.15pm. The North Americans, however, are returning from a heavy 4-0 defeat against the Netherlands who will certainly be among the protagonists of the next European Championships.

The friendly match against the tough North Americans will represent a precious opportunity for Deschamps’ team to test the team’s resilience and to try new game plans. The Blues will have to take the field with the right concentration and determination to avoid surprises and achieve their second consecutive success in view of Euro 2024. They will face Canada which is experiencing a moment of strong technical growth. He is fresh from the historic qualification for the 2022 World Cup and intends to play a leading role in the international football scene and the match against France represents an important test to test his level of competitiveness.

Maignan will most likely be featured again between the posts, the last bastion of a defense that will see Upamecano and Saliba in the role of central defenders flanked on the right by Inter player Pavard and AC Milan player Theo Hernandez on the opposite side. Also on this occasion, the Rossoneri Giroud will be the point of reference in attack for the French team, supported by Mbappé and the Paris Saint Germain striker Dembélé. Behind them on the right lane the Juventus player Rabiot, Tchouameni in the control room and the Atletico Madrid midfielder Griezmann on the left lane.

Canada, on the other hand, to face France, will certainly rely on the speed of Alphonso Davies of Bayern Munich and the scoring ability of Cyle Larin who will partner with David in attack. In midfield Buchanan and Millar will act on the external lanes flanked by Kone and Eustaquio. The defensive department will see St Clair proposed to defend the goal with Johnston at right back and Davies acting on the left alongside central defenders Bombito and Cornelius.
